The Minnesota Wild have activated forward Michael Milne from injured reserve and placed him on waivers to assign him to the AHL’s Iowa Wild. The 23-year-old winger, who had a brief NHL debut last season and scored 26 points in 60 games with Iowa, is now medically cleared to practice after an undisclosed injury but faces uncertainty regarding his future with the team next summer.
